In this study, we examined how two different CCS models, a contributory design and a co-created design, influenced science self-efficacy and science interest among youth CCS participants.

This research investigates how eight undergraduate African American women in science, math, and engineering (SME) majors accessed cultural capital and informal science learning opportunities from preschool to college. It uses the multiple case study methodological approach and cultural capital as frameworks to better understand the participants’ opportunities to engage in informal science learning or free-choice learning. The impact of two science enrichment programs on the science attitudes of 330 gifted high school students was evaluated using a multimethod, multiperspective approach that provided a more comprehensive evaluation of program impact on science attitudes than did previous assessments of science programs. Although pre-post comparisons did not indicate positive impact on science attitudes, other measures provided strong evidence of program effectiveness. This article summates findings from research at the Museum National d'Histoire Naturelle that evaluated and compared visitor behavior in the gardens, main galleries and two temporary exhibits.
